Dennis Hopper Choopers1 (6) DENNIS HOPPER CHOPPERS – GIRL WALKED OUT OF TOWN –

D WINK

Another fine slice of dusk til dawn Americana. Lifted from their excellent LP Be Ready.

 

2 (4) THE TRAVELLING BAND – SUNDIAL XXMI – COOKING VINYL

Now a festival anthem and set for a well deserved re-release. Inspiring.

 

3 (9) DJANGO DJANGO – WAVEFORMS – BECAUSE

Modern groovy psychedelia that brings The Stone Roses, The Beta Band and Low era David Bowie to mind.

 

4 (10) RICHARD WARREN – THE LONESOME SINGER…- TV

Dark country blues with a 50’s twilight twang. Comes backed with the beautiful “Wasteland”, sort of Richard Hawley meets Timber Timbre.

 

5 (13) AMBASSADEURS – COME A LITTLE CLOSER EP – JALAPENO

A sunny afternoon in Toon Town, followed by soulful trip hop and rounded off with an off kilter version of Marvin Gaye’s “Ain’t That Perculiar”.

 

6 (25) LE VOLUME COURBE – THEODAURUS REX EP – PICKPOCKET

Charlotte Marionneau’s sedutive yet innocent vocals totally compliment the beautiful and fragile Kevin Shield’s song I Love The Living You.

 

7 (18) THE FIELD – LOOPING STATE OF MIND – KOMPAKT

Modern atmospheric electronics swirl around old school Balearic rhythms building into various states of euphoria. Get right on one matey!

 

8 (16) SUBMOTION ORCHESTRA – ALWAYS – EXCEPTIONAL BLUE

Soulful, exhilarating, genre defying and in a class of its own. Laxx skanks it up nice.

 

9 (7) THE JAPANESE POPSTARS – TAKE FOREVER – VIRGIN

The lipstick king Robert Smith soars over pulsing gothic disco. Attaque comes up trumps on the remix front, delivering wall climbing take no prisoners techno.

 

10 (NEW) KURT VILE – SO OUTTA REACH EP – MATADOR

Five outstanding brand new songs from the “Smoke Ring For My Halo” sessions, plus a take on Bruce Springsteen’s “Downbound Train”. What more could you ask for.

 

11 (NEW) WE WERE PROMISSED JETPACKS – IN THE PIT OF THE STOMACH – FAT CAT

Their second LP sees them brimming with confidence as they take it up a few notches. Energy fuelled anthems & wigouts are the order of the day.

 

12 (14) CLOCK OPERA – LESSON No.7 – MOSHI MOSHI / ISLAND

Coming on like a 50’s teen idol before going for the sky is the limit with driving drums, fast guitars and ascending keys.

 

13 (24) THE GOLDEN FILTER – SYNDROMES – PERFECTLY ISOLATED

The New York duo have made a short film and accompanying soundtrack about a girl with mysterious talents. Deliciously spooky.

 

14 (27) THE LOVELY EGGS – PANIC PLANTS – CHERRYADE

A psychedelic sing a long about OCD in the village hall after a hard days graft on the allotment.

 

15 (26) K-X-P – EASY – MELODIC

Glam rock, Balearic beat, post punk, kraut rock and The Banana Splits all get a look in.

 

16 (NEW) CHRIS COCO – HOLIDAY – MELODICA

Like watching old Super 8 films to a dreamy soundtrack featuring Samantha Whates creating a fantastic 60’s sophisticated European vibe. Lovely.

 

17 (NEW) THE BROKEN VINYL CLUB – THE BROKEN VINYL CLUB – ACID JAZZ

Debut LP of swinging 60’s influenced pop, complete with well thought out harmonies and all those very important details & licks that make this a worthy nostalgic trip.

 

18 (17) TOTALLY ENORMOUS EXTINCT DINOSAURS – GARDEN REMIXES –

POLYDOR

Luisa from Lulu & The Lampshades shares the vocals and Hot Chip’s Joe Goddard leads the remix onslaught. Soul Clap and Hackman do the do.

 

19 (NEW) JASMINE KARA – BLUES AIN’T NOTHING BUT A GOOD WOMAN GONE BAD – ACID JAZZ

A soulful pop star in the making and on the rise with the Chess Records seal of approval.

 

20 (NEW) CONNAN MOCKASIN – FAKING JAZZ TOGETHER – BECAUSE / PHANTASY

Tom Furse of The Horrors fame takes this to another level, cooking up percussive rhythms, a dubby bassline and far out electronics. A bit like an early Andrew Weatherall production.

 

21 (23) TEEN DAZE – A SILENT PLANET – LEFSE

Six tracks of floaty blissed out loveliness to immerse yourself in.

 

22 (28) BRIOSKI – RADIOACTIVITY – NANG

21st Century Italo disco. The Emperor Machine Stretched Version takes it into orbit.

 

23 (NEW) RADICAL MAJIK – MENTAL HEALTH – THE BOARDROOM PRESENTS

The Boardroom Collective have set up their own label and the debut release is 3 cuts of deep house, off kilter techno and mutant disco with all manner of influences & subtleties. Nice.

 

24 (30) MUSTANG – SHOOTING LOVE – DIFFERENT

Contemporary synth pop with 80’s big hair, fake tan & shoulder pads. Black Strobe and Jeremy Glen take it to the disco.

 

25 (NEW) HEADMAN – BE LOVED – RELISH

Daniel Avery ventures into the dark side of old school Chicago with his Divided Love Remix.
